>>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
>> [Switching to LWP 4]
>> 0x004b08b8 in TPQCONNECTION__LOADFIELD (CURSOR=0xfad601a0,
>> FIELDDEF=0xfad30f20, BUFFER=0xfa5f00bc, CREATEBLOB=fa
>> 803               if FIntegerDatetimes then dbl^ := pint64(buffer)^/1000000;
>
> Not sure if it applies to your case, but afaik SPARC requires natural
> alignment for memory accesses. "buffer" is not aligned to 8 bytes
> here... (0xfa5f00bc <---)

We only support 32 bit SPARC, and there we split a 64 bit load into  
two 32 bit loads. dbl, assuming it points to a double, should point to  
a 64 bit-aligned memory location though (depending on the cpu, 32 bit  
alignment may be sufficient, but better be safe than sorry).
